Ingredients: 1 bell pepper (any color or a combination of colors) 1/2 onion 1 garlic clove, minced or chopped 1/2 jalapeno (optional if you like very spicy) 1/2 cup frozen corn (optional) 1 cup baby spinach 1 tablespoon olive oil Any blend of spices such as cumin, cayenne pepper, thyme, Cajun spice, etc. salt & pepper to taste 1 can black beans or beans of your choice Corn tortillas Salsa, guacamole

Directions: |
Directions:1) Cut up bell pepper, onion and garlic. Heat oil over medium-high heat in skillet and throw in garlic, onion, bell pepper and jalapeno if using. Sprinkle liberally with spices of your choice and stir. 2) While veggies are cooking warm beans in a small pot on the stove and add in some chili powder or any other seasonings you like. 3) After veggies start to soften throw in corn. 4) Add spinach just before it's ready, it only takes about a minute to cook. 5) When veggies are done and beans are warm, heat up a couple corn tortillas and layer with veggies, beans, and salsa and/or guacamole. *One thing you might try with this recipe is to buy some Soy Curls, rehydrate them in faux chicken flavoring while you're chopping up the vegetables, and throw them in when you add the corn. This adds another flavor and texture to the dish. I buy the Soy Curls & faux chicken bouillon cubes from www.veganessentials.com but you can probably buy them in health food stores too. |
